Cómo instalar Adminer en Ubuntu 20.04 LTS

En este artículo veremos cómo instalar Adminer en Ubuntu 20.04 LTS Focal Fossa paso a paso, de modo que podamos administrar varios motores de bases de datos en nuestro servidor o VPS Ubuntu, tanto local como remotamente, gracias a su sencilla pero potente interfaz web.

Antes de instalar Adminer en Ubuntu 20.04

Si quieres completar con éxito los pasos de nuestra guía de instalación de Adminer en Ubuntu 20.04 LTS Focal Fossa será necesario cumplir estas condiciones:

  • Un sistema Ubuntu 20.04 LTS Focal Fossa actualizado.
  • Un entorno o pila tipo LAMP (servicio web con PHP y motor de bases de datos).
  • Acceso a terminal de comandos con un usuario con permisos de sudo.
  • Conexión a Internet.

Si no dispones del entorno necesario, puedes consultar previamente nuestra guía de instalación de la pila LAMP en Ubuntu 20.04 LTS. Es importante trabajar sobre HTTPS, aunque por motivos didácticos en este artículo lo hacemos sobre HTTP, aunque es fácil realizar la configuración con la ayuda de nuestra guía de instalación de Apache en Ubuntu 20.04 LTS.

Cómo descargar Adminer para Ubuntu 20.04

Vamos a descargar Adminer para Ubuntu 20.04 LTS desde la sección de descarga del sitio web oficial de la aplicación:

como descargar adminer para ubuntu 20.04 lts focal fossa

Encontramos varias opciones de descarga (en inglés exclusivamente, sólo para MySQL, etc.), siendo el primer archivo el que descargaremos:

~$ wget https://www.adminer.org/latest.php

Cómo instalar Adminer en Ubuntu 20.04

Para instalar Adminer en Ubuntu 20.04 LTS realizaremos una serie de tareas encaminadas a preparar el sistema.

Archivos de Adminer

Creamos el directorio para Adminer:

~$ sudo mkdir /usr/share/adminer

Y moveremos el archivo que acabamos de descargar, dándole un nombre más descriptivo:

~$ sudo mv latest.php /usr/share/adminer/adminer.php

Servicio web

Para hacer navegable la aplicación, creamos una configuración de Apache para Adminer:

~$ sudo nano /etc/apache2/conf-available/adminer.conf

El contenido será el alias que usaremos para acceder:

Alias /adminer /usr/share/adminer/adminer.php

Guardamos los cambios y activamos la nueva configuración:

~$ sudo a2enconf adminer

Y recargamos la configuración del servicio web:

~$ sudo systemctl reload apache2

PHP

Adminer requerirá la presencia en Ubuntu 20.04 LTS de las extensiones necesarias para conectar con los distintos motores de bases de datos que queramos utilizar. Si usamos la versión incluida con Ubuntu 20.04 instalaremos las extensiones del siguiente modo:

~$ sudo apt install -y php-mysql php-pgsql php-sqlite3

Pero si usamos el repositorio alternativo, habrá que indicar el número de versión en el nombre de las extensiones; por ejemplo, para la versión 8.0:

~$ sudo apt install -y php8.0-mysql php8.0-pgsql php8.0-sqlite3

Obviamente, puedes instalar únicamente las extensiones que te interesen.

Terminada la descarga e instalación habrá que recargar la configuración del servicio web:

~$ sudo systemctl reload apache2

Cómo acceder a Adminer en Ubuntu 20.04

Para acceder a Adminer en Ubuntu 20.04 LTS desde un navegador bastará con añadir a la dirección IP o nombre DNS del servidor el alias que hayamos configurado.

Por ejemplo, la máquina Ubuntu 20.04 sobre la que hemos realizado este tutorial es accesible en el subdominio ubuntu2004.local.lan, así que al haber configurado el alias /adminer podemos utilizar http://ubuntu2004.local.lan/adminer como URL:

como instalar adminer en ubuntu 20.04 lts focal fossa

Seleccionaremos el motor de bases de datos al que queramos conectar, indicando el usuario y la contraseña, con lo que accederemos a la página principal

instalar adminer en ubuntu 20.04 lts focal fossa

Ya podemos trabajar con las opciones que nos ofrece la interfaz web de Adminer, teniendo en cuenta el nivel de privilegios del usuario con el que hayamos conectado.

Conclusión

Ahora que sabes cómo instalar Adminer en Ubuntu 20.04 LTS Focal Fossa ya puedes administrar distintos motores de bases de datos con la misma aplicación, de forma local o remota, con la comodidad de una sencilla e intuitiva interfaz web.

Si tienes dudas o preguntas, tienes sugerencias de mejora de este artículo, crees que necesita ser actualizado o quieres notificar posibles errores, la mejor opción es dejar un comentario. Los revisamos constantemente.

¡Apoya comoinstalar.me!

¿Ya tienes todo listo para administrar tus bases de datos gracias a nuestra guía de instalación de Adminer en Ubuntu 20.04 LTS? En ese caso quizás quieras mostrar tu agradecimiento contribuyendo a mantener en línea este sitio y a la creación de nuevos artículos de temas como Ubuntu 20.04 o Adminer, y puedes hacerlo invitándome a un café:

 

O dejando 1 $ de propina en PayPal:

¡Gracias!

Valora esta entrada

5/5 - (1 voto)

Deja un comentario